Pendeta (scholar) Za'ba or Tan Sri Zainal Abidin Bin Ahmad was born at Kg. Bukit Kerdas, Batu Kikir, Negeri Sembilan on 16 September 1895.He had his first formal study at Sekolah Melayu Batu Kikir when he was twelve years old. After that, he was send to Linggi to take his Arabic and al-Quran learning there. He then study at St. Paul Institutions, Seremban and passed his Senior Cambridge exam in 1916. 1 Jun 1916 - He began his career as temporary teachear at the Bukit Zahra English School, Johor Bahru 10 April 1917 - Married Rafeah (Urai) Mohd. Hasban and had one daughter named Raihanah 2 Julai 1917 - Get divorced. Disember 1917 - Married with Fatimah (Che Teh) Umar and had five kids they are Zaharah, Zamrud, Ahmad Murtadza, Mohd. Redha and Zaitun. 3 Oktober 1918 - He had an offered as English and Malay teacher at Malay College, Kuala Kangsar.1920-1921: Took Senior Normal Education Class in Taiping and then had his certificate in teaching. 1 Jun 1923: Started his career as translator and Malay translator at the Department of the Assistant Director of Education for the Faderated Malay State and the State Sattlement. 1 April 1924: Transfered to Sultan Idris Training College (SITC), Tanjong Malim to establish the Translating Department that then become Writing and Composition Department. 1947: He was appointed lecturer of Malay Langguage at the School of Orientel and African Studies in London University. 16 September 1950: Retired 29 September 1952: Started his work as senior lecturer cum Head of Malay Studies Department at the University of Malaya, Singapore until 31st December 1958. 21 September 1956: PENDITA title was awarded to Za'ba. ObjectivesTo acknowledge Za'ba's contributins in the fields of langguange, literature, religion, politics and education as wall as socio-cultural aspects. To commemorate the place of birth of Za'ba as well as a gesture of appreciation by the state government to his kin To set up a tourist attraction which is educational in nature especially for researchers, academicians and students To enable the society to appreciate a prominent public figure by reviewing his personal collection and evidence of his contributions To provide a suitable location to exhibit Za'ba's memoirs and memorabilla apart from those at the National Archive and University Malaya. |
